Unit 'dbuscomp' Package
[Overview][Types][Classes][Procedures and functions][Index] [#dbus]

TDBusMessage

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: dbuscomp.pp line 106

type TDBusMessage = class(TObject)

protected

  class function MessageType; virtual; abstract;

  procedure AllocateMessage; virtual; abstract;

  procedure CheckNotFromSource;

  procedure CheckNotAllocated;

  procedure CheckAllocated;

  function Allocated;

  function Copy;

  procedure Error();

  property Message: PDBusMessage; [r]

  property FromSource: Boolean; [r]

  property Serial: dbus_uint32_t; [r]

  property ReplySerial: dbus_uint32_t; [rw]

public

  constructor Create(); virtual;

  destructor Destroy; override;

  procedure Append();

  procedure AppendArgument();

  procedure Get();

  procedure GetArgument();

  function GetNextArgumentType;

  function GetArrayElementType;

  function HasPath(); virtual;

  function HasSender(); virtual;

  function HasSignature(); virtual;

  function IsError(); virtual;

end;

Inheritance

TDBusMessage

|

TObject


Documentation generated on: 2023-03-18